Lamlash lies 4 miles to the south of Arran’s main ferry port at Brodick. The village lies on the east coast of the Isle and is the largest in terms of population with approximately 1,000 residents. The village is a popular tourist destination and offers a wide range of hotels and holiday accommodation including a number of popular bars and eateries as well as convenience retail and local boutiques together with a local church and community medical centre. Arran High School, lies to the south of the village and the University of the Highlands and Islands resource hub and Council offices are also located in the village.
